Policy Analysis of Cervical Cancer Screening Strategies in Low-Resource Settings—Correction

JAMA. 2001;286:1026.

Reference Incorrectly Cited. In the Original Contribution entitled "Policy Analysis of Cervical Cancer Screening Strategies in Low-Resource Settings: Clinical Benefits and Cost-effectiveness" published in the June 27, 2001, issue of THE JOURNAL (2001;285:3107-3115), the reference was cited incorrectly. On page 3114, reference 9, "Visual inspection with acetic acid for cervical-cancer screening: test qualities in a primary-care setting: University of Zimbabwe/JHPIEGO Cervical Cancer Project. Lancet. 1999;353:869-873." should be "University of Zimbabwe/JHPIEGO Cervical Cancer Project. Visual inspection with acetic acid for cervical-cancer screening: test qualities in a primary-care setting. Lancet. 1999;353:869-873."
